(Product Registration Application System)
This PRAS short course is being introduced to assist all concerned in the process of application for registration of fertilizer products – companies, consultants and individuals. Registration of such products is obligatory in terms of Act 36 of 1947 (as amended from time to time). It is anticipated that by introducing this course, the process will be better understood and more easily applied, contributing to greater efficiency and reduced application times and frustration.
It is recommended that persons applying for this module should have at least a background of Grade 12 Mathematics / Mathematical Literacy and Chemistry.
The course will comprise a distance module, with two assignments, a theoretical examination and a practical session in which an application for the registration of a product will need to be completed.
After registration, course material will be sent to participants. A Zoom session will be arranged to explain the process and identify challenges. The assignments will need to be completed to assess progress and the examination duration is three hours (one and a half hour theory, one and a half hour practical).
After successful completion, an attendance certificate will be issued.
